Richard Hammond Posted August 26, 2008 Share Posted August 26, 2008 There is a way but its a bit long winded, youd have to install Windows XP in Bootcamp then use XP to rip the disc then demux the video and audio using TSMuxer, extract AC3 stream using EAC3TO then remux the video and audio in a .TS container using TSMuxer, the resulting file should play fine in VLC.
